FERPA Policies
Hannibal-LaGrange University adheres to the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A). The privacy and confidentiality of all student records shall be preserved. Official student academic records, supporting documents, and other student files shall be maintained only by members of the college staff hired for that purpose.
Separate files are maintained for the following educational records: admissions and academic records, supporting documents, and general education records and financial records in the office of registrar and the office of business affairs; and financial aid records in the financial aid office.
HLGU has designated the following items as directory information: student name, address, email address, Student ID, telephone number, date and place of birth, major field of study, advisor, participation in officially recognized activities and sports, weight and height of members of athletic teams, dates of attendance, degrees and awards received, and most previous school attended. The university may disclose any of those items without prior consent, unless notified in writing to the contrary at the time of registration for each term.
